Running Rottweiler Puppies for sale

Rottweilers, often referred to as 'Rotties', are robust, powerful dogs known for their distinctive black-and-rust coat. The breed originated in Germany as drover dogs, which is reflected in their sturdy, muscular build. Despite their formidable appearance, Rottweilers are generally good-natured and fiercely loyal. Rottweilers fit well into many roles: as working dogs, they excel in search and rescue, as guide dogs for the blind, and in other forms of service. In family settings, they make protective companions and gentle playmates, if properly socialized and trained. Rottweilers generally have a short double coat that's black with clearly defined rust-colored markings. They do not come in size variations, but adult males can weigh up to 135 pounds, and females up to 100 pounds. Rotties require regular exercise and mental stimulation due to their intelligent, energetic nature.

FAQs

How much does a Rottweiler cost?

The average cost of a purebred Rottweiler puppy in the United Kingdom is approximately £781, though prices can vary based on factors such as pedigree, breeder reputation, and location.

Are Rottweilers a good family dog?

Rottweilers can be good family dogs if properly trained and socialized from a young age. They are loyal, protective, and often gentle with children, but they require consistent supervision and firm, positive guidance. It's important to ensure they are well-socialized to prevent aggressive tendencies.

What is a Rottweilers weakness?

Rottweilers can be prone to health issues such as hip dysplasia and certain heart problems. They also require consistent training and socialization to prevent aggressive tendencies. Without proper guidance, they may become overly territorial or dominant.

Are Rottweilers high maintenance?

Rottweilers can be considered moderately high maintenance due to their need for regular exercise, consistent training, and socialization. They also require grooming and health care to keep them in good condition. However, with proper care and attention, they make loyal and well-behaved companions.

Can Rottweilers get aggressive?

Rottweilers can display aggressive behavior if not properly trained or socialized, but they are not inherently aggressive. With consistent training, socialization, and responsible ownership, they are typically calm, loyal, and protective companions.
